

It is with deep love and sorrow that we announce the passing of Bryan Lane, who left us on July 27, 2025, at the age of 58. He was born on November 14, 1966, in Tampa, Florida, and lived a life marked by kindness, strength, and unwavering devotion to those he loved.
Bryan was a beloved son, husband, father, grandfather, brother, and friend; remembered for his dedication to the Lord. He touched the lives of many with his kindness, wisdom, and sense of humor. He always found time to help others and to spend time with his family.
He spent much of his life working as a Pipefitter with UA Local 123, where he was respected for hard work, leadership, safety, and compassion. Outside of work, Bryan found joy in playing his guitar, listening to good music, building his collections, and spending time at the beach with family. He will be remembered for his bright and warm smile and for how deeply he loved.
Bryan is survived by his wife Patricia Lane, their daughter Candance Smith, her husband Matthew Smith and his grandson Zachary, his son Alan Goss and his granddaughter Alianna, his father and mother Frank and Linda Lane, his brother Tim Lane and his wife Rhonda, and his sister Lori Bogni and her husband Shane who will carry forward his memory with love and pride, along with many nieces and nephews.
Bryan was preceded in death by his brother Jimmy Lane.
A visitation for Bryan will be held Saturday, August 9, 2025, from 1:00 PM to 2:00 PM at Blount & Curry Funeral Home-Carrollwood, 3207 W Bearss Ave, Tampa, FL 33618, followed by a funeral service from 2:00 PM to 3:00 PM.
